Have you heard about our 106G MiniPod? 🤔 The 106G MiniPod is a ruggedised GNSS receiver that complements the operation of a nearby standard subsea positioning beacon. It is suited to coastal construction tasks where deep-rated submersible vehicles may periodically break the surface. For those who are in the dredging, cable laying or trenching industries, we have the solution for you. Part of AAE Technologies, Applied Acoustics provides advanced subsea and marine navigation, positioning, and survey solutions. 🌊 🔧 Their pioneering UK-developed products serve clients worldwide across sectors such as oil and gas, renewable energy, academia, and defense. Products such as their Easytrak USBL Systems offer precise underwater tracking for multiple assets, including divers and UUVs. With built-in pitch, roll, and heading sensors, these compact systems are ideal for various range and accuracy requirements. 🔗 Explore Applied Acoustics' innovative solutions on OST: https://hubs.la/Q02QzQBh0 #subsea #marine #technology #navigation

TGS has successfully completed the acquisition of an ultra-high-resolution 3D (UHR3D) survey on behalf of Community Offshore Wind in the New York Bight. The survey characterized soil conditions at the site, which is critical for designing the offshore wind project. The survey commenced in October 2023 and had a total duration of more than eight months. Read the full release: https://hubs.ly/Q02Q0CYP0
